We are thrilled to welcome Emily Reynolds to our theatre for our first In Conversation of the new season. After the 27 September performance of The Human Voice, she will share her insights on mental health, gender and tech as they relate to the themes of this iconic play.
This In Conversation is for those who are interested in exploring the effect that technology is having on our relationships and our mental health. It will explore how Joan Cocteau’s original play, which was written almost a century ago, is as relevant today as ever.
Emily has written for WIRED magazine, NY Mag, the Guardian, Times Literary Supplement, New Statesman, BBC and many more. She was recently awarded DIVA Magazine's Journalist of the Year award. Emily makes regular media appearances having appeared on Newstalk, the FiveThirtyEight podcast, Radio 4's Today Programme and Woman's Hour to name a few.
